Preferred Term:
dihydroxyphenylalanine
Definition:
A beta-hydroxylated derivative of phenylalanine. The D-form of dihydroxyphenylalanine has less physiologic activity than the L-form and is commonly used experimentally to determine whether the pharmacological effects of levodopa are stereospecific.
